British police are interrogating five people after toddlers suffered unexplained broken limbs at a nursery.
Officers were called in after three children aged between 12 months and two years were injured at the Rocking Horse Nursery in Nottinghamshire, Great Britain.
The injuries reportedly include a broken leg suffered by a boy.
"All the children involved are aged between one and two years, and officers have questioned five people in connection with the investigation, a Nottinghamshire Police spokesman told SkyNews.
Sources said the injuries were not the result of sexual abuse.
